html52.com
我爱小程序-开发者交流社区

微信开发者工具修改基础库为2.25.0版本,canvas渲染失败?

使用微信开发者工具将基础库修改为2.25.0版本后 canvas position:fixed 动态修改left后渲染失败。

经过测试此问题从2.24.4版本起就会出现。

https://developers.weixin.qq.com/s/JlCUXzmi7FA3

以上是基于官方提供的demo修改后复现问题的分享代码

复现步骤:

复现步骤:如图所示刚开始将left设置为:9999px,即离屏状态

如图所示刚开始将left设置为:9999px,即离屏状态

如图所示刚开始将left设置为:9999px,即离屏状态然后通过设置定时任务将left设置为空,即进入屏幕状态。会无法绘制。

然后通过设置定时任务将left设置为空,即进入屏幕状态。会无法绘制。

然后通过设置定时任务将left设置为空,即进入屏幕状态。会无法绘制。不动态修改left的话绘制没有问题。

不动态修改left的话绘制没有问题。

我们的需求是需要动态的显示隐藏canvas,所以采用这种方式。如果能有其他方式替代也请说明,谢谢!

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

真正的个人免签约支付接口

云免签H5支付